BIBLE TRANSLATION HISTORY • NT 1881; OT 1885
Revised Version RV
Who made it?
British revision companies with American participation.
Why was it made?
To revise the KJV in light of advances in Hebrew/Greek scholarship and English usage.
How did it develop?
The RV was the first officially authorized major revision of the KJV tradition. Its New Testament appeared in 1881 and Old Testament in 1885. It incorporated nineteenth-century textual criticism and became a parent of the ASV.
What source texts did it use?
Masoretic Hebrew; nineteenth-century critical Greek scholarship
